技术文摘
华为手机应用安装失败提示签名不一致的解决办法
2025-01-08 23:42:45 小编
华为手机应用安装失败提示签名不一致的解决办法
在使用华为手机时,不少用户可能会遇到应用安装失败且提示签名不一致的问题,这着实让人困扰。不过别担心,通过一些有效的方法,这个问题是可以解决的。
了解一下为什么会出现签名不一致的提示。应用签名是开发者用来标识应用身份的一种方式,就如同一个独特的“身份证”。当手机检测到安装的应用签名与系统中已存在的同类型应用签名不就会弹出该提示并阻止安装,这是手机系统出于安全考虑的一种保护机制。
一种常见的解决方法是卸载旧版本应用。有时候,新应用安装失败是因为手机中还残留着旧版本且签名不同的应用。我们只需在手机主屏幕上长按要卸载的应用图标,点击“卸载”选项,将旧版本应用彻底移除,然后再尝试安装新应用,或许就能顺利解决签名不一致的问题。
如果卸载旧版本后问题依旧,那么可能需要清理应用数据和缓存。进入手机的“设置”,找到“应用管理”选项,在众多应用列表中找到安装失败的应用,点击进入应用详情页面,选择“存储”选项,在这里点击“清除数据”和“清除缓存”按钮。这一步操作可以清除可能干扰新应用安装的残留数据,之后重新安装应用,看是否能够成功。
还有一种情况是,可能因为安装来源不正规导致签名不一致。建议大家从华为应用市场等官方正规渠道下载应用,确保应用的签名和来源可靠。如果是从第三方网站下载的应用,出现签名不一致问题的概率就会增加。
通过上述方法,大多数华为手机应用安装失败提示签名不一致的问题都能得到有效解决。在日常使用中,养成良好的应用下载和管理习惯,能让我们的手机使用体验更加顺畅,避免类似问题的频繁出现。
- Go 接口实现隐式机制:结构体何时算实现接口?
- OpenTelemetry Tracer中otel.Tracer(name)方法实现配置跟踪器的方式
- Go语言中简化哈希计算、文件处理和加密解密的实用库有哪些
- Pydantic的Anyurl方法返回None值,为何方法声明中有str.__init__等参数
- 修复Windows上PHP Curl HTTPS证书颁发机构问题的方法
- Python中用for+if提取包含省略号数据的方法
- 把数据层独立成 RPC 是否可行
- Go结构体对象调用接收指针类型方法的方法
- 函数中使用对象及对象属性时参数选择:传整个对象还是属性更佳
- Go语言中Scanln函数忽略部分输入的原因
- Python生成指定范围内指定个数随机浮点数的方法
- Redis Stream 数据类型转换谜团:插入的 int 型 user_id 读出为何成 string?
- Go中float64类型值的解析方法
- OpenTelemetry里otel.Tracer(name)函数的使用方法
- Pydantic库中validator的per参数控制校验方法执行顺序的方法